Excellent built and finish. Good optics. Quality Control Issues?
ADDENDUM - Quality or design issues?After my initial test, I noticed again some recurring focusing issues leading to dual imaging. I noticed lack of sharpness and objects coming to focus twice. In these conditions I could not calibrate the dioptric at all. However by gently sending forth and back to the full extent the dioptric wheel, the inter-pupillary regulations and the focusing gears (all three!) then the dual imaging seemed to disappear and I could regulate the dioptric again.It seems that there is some differential play in the focusing gears of the two arm. Whatever it is, it is clearly a fault and I returned it for a refund.I usually do not score down items because of a single fault. Even the most reliable products can fail and one statistical sample is not enough to judge.However I noticed other complaints on focusing and I am now more reluctant to recommend this otherwise very good binoculars.__________I have a modern and excellent Hawke 8x42 roof prism, an old Bresser 10x42 roof prism and an older but excellent Russian KOMS BPC5 8x30 porro prism binoculars.This is a compact model so it is unfair to compare those with it. They offer a much better viewing experience, especially so with the Hawke and KOMS.However I agree entirely with the excellent reviews on both Amazon and on the specialised web sites.The built and finish is excellent, inspiring quality and confidence. It is waterproof and nitrogen purged. Mechanically they are good although a little heavy for a compact 10x25. The focus gear is very smooth but has some minimal play and is a little too sensitive. Range is excellent with outstanding close focus and good FOV (105m at 1000 m). Optically they are well specified with fully multicoated optics and BaK 4 prism (not phase corrected). For a little more the excellent Hawke Frontier 10x25 offer PC prisms. However in use they showed no annoying aberrations, good colour rendition and resolution especially in the center. Contrast is also excellent. They are bright for the small size. The eyecups are very well made with simple operation and good stability. They allow viewing with spectacles. The dioptric adjustment is easy to operate and stiff enough to maintain position.I did find accurate calibration difficult to obtain. I am not sure if the focus mechanism in my unit has some relative variability in the two arms. I did not have such issue with another model of small compacts.They do not come with any lens cover. This is not a bad thing in itself, but the protective case is an issue: it is made of decent material, but it is not of the best design and is way too tight.All in all a highly recommended pair of binoculars especially for sport events, travelling light and the occasional holiday excursions just missing out on five stars.
